Want a taste of old Nags Head? ‘The Beach House’ is a historical treasure on the Nags Head oceanfront with an added private pool and hot tub! The pool area has great ocean views. The Beach House has the tallest ocean front observation/sunbathing tower on the Outer Banks with a 360 degree view of the ocean, the sound, and Jockey's Ridge. At night you will be able to catch a glimpse of the light from Bodie Island lighthouse. This property is over 100 years old, and dates back to the days the inland farmers would bring their families to the beach to escape the heat and deadly mosquitoes for beach breezes all summer long! After generations with the same family, it was purchased by owners that respected the history of the property and wanted to add their own touch with the whimsical and fun decor theme of roosters and chickens. If you are interested in a unique destination filled with rich history this is the spot for you. Floor, walls and ceiling is original tongue in groove planking that has been restored and refinished. You can see the original nails from the sanding of the floor planks. 

Central heat and air throughout the property has been added and the kitchen and bathrooms completely redone with granite, new fixtures, farm sink, and washer and dryer. LCD TV’s throughout the property. The bunk room on the west side does have an additional window unit for those extra hot days just in case. There is a separate room off the back-deck original to the property, now for a study work area with computer and desk, plus there is wireless internet access throughout property and study. Located between Jockey’s Ridge and the Atlantic Ocean, you can see Jockey’s Ridge from the property. What a great location to base active families on the go! Hang gliding, climbing Jockey’s Ridge, kite flying, playing in the ocean, sunning or enjoying the private pool and hot tub are available with easy access. There is a shared dune top gazebo beach access you share with only 2 small semi oceanfront apartments next to the property. The pool and hot tub are your private amenities. Restaurants, shopping, seafood and farm market are within walking distance. Close to family activities including water sports, go carts, putt-putt, and a sound side park and theater for outdoor movies on the lawn.

Enjoy the remarkable panoramic views from the 51 ft observation/sunbathing tower! On the lower deck there will be a couch, two chairs, and a coffee table with outdoor carpet. This is a perfect play area for small children. Entry from the first deck to the higher decks will be controlled by a high "pool-like" gate. Entry from the house to the tower will be controlled with a security code preventing unwanted access. On the second level of the deck there will be 4 comfortable chairs to enjoy the view. On the third level of the deck you will be able to enjoy the breeze from the swing facing the ocean. The top level is where you will be able to see panoramic views of the ocean, Jockey's Ridge, the light from Bodie Island Lighthouse at night, and amazing views of the sunset! There will be chaise loungers for sunbathing too! The tower will have motion-activated solar lighting for all stairwells up to the top for easy viewing at night.

This property is more than 800 feet from a public beach access, giving you a more secluded feel.

The idea wasn’t to set out and establish a new concept restaurant on the Outer Banks, but that’s exactly what Awful Arthur’s owner Jo Whitehead and her late husband, Jay, accomplished more than 35 years ago when they opened the area’s first authentic oyster bar.

 

Awful Arthur’s opened in May 1984 on the Outer Banks. “We embraced the concept of an authentic copper top bar with the idea of it being a major drawing card and it still is,” explains Whitehead. “I get oysters wherever they are local. We follow the warm waters.” 

 

Just across from the ocean, in Kill Devil Hills, oyster season is year-round at Awful Arthur’s. Diners can take a seat at the copper-topped bar to observe the staff shucking oysters, served raw or steamed, along with shrimp, crab legs and clams all steamed to perfection. 

 

It’s not just the raw bar that’s earned Awful Arthur’s both local and national recognition, including being named one of America’s greatest oyster bars by Coastal Living magazine. The restaurant is a seafood-lover’s paradise, offering the freshest catches available.
